Why Prompt Engineering is Important?
Prompt engineering is essential for eliciting clear and actionable responses from LLMs like GPT-4. How we frame questions or create prompts can significantly enhance the relevance and accuracy of AI-generated outputs, making it vital for improving business operations. During our session, participants applied real-world scenarios to refine their prompt engineering techniques, interacting with a finance dataset using different GPT models.

 

Lab Sessions: Comparing GPT-4 and GPT-4o Mini
The session included practical exercises using GPT models to analyze datasets. We compared the capabilities of GPT-4—known for its superior data processing—with GPT-4o Mini, which, although faster, does not handle complex tasks as effectively. This highlighted the importance of choosing the right AI model for specific business objectives, especially when accuracy and complexity matter.

Customizing GPT for Specific Roles
We also explored the potential of creating custom GPTs tailored to particular roles within a business. Whether it’s functioning as a financial analyst or adhering to IFRS standards, customizing GPT models helps ensure AI outputs are aligned with business-specific data and practices. This customization is particularly valuable in industries that require high precision, such as finance.

Chain of Thought Prompting for Strategic Planning
The session introduced the concept of chain of thought prompting—where prompts lead the AI through progressively more complex responses. This method is especially useful for tasks like strategic planning, allowing businesses to fine-tune their AI tools for objectives like market analysis and revenue forecasting.
